>        I am doing my first feast with-in a month. The hall will hold 100,
>but my shire advisers said to plan for 48. I am making meat pies and
>dumplings ahead and freezing them. But my real concern is what do I do if
>the morning of the event 50 more people decide to stay for feast. Do I run
>to the store and buy all the food over again and make every thing again.
>This point is making me real nervous. I will welcome any of your suggestions
>or horror stories (only if they have HAPPY ENDINGS)
>
>Anna OftderTurm

First, decide that no matter what the feast will happen, and happen
successfully.  I would make a plan to add other things that you could
prepare that day if you get more people.  A stew, if you have kitchen help
to cut everything.  Plain rice, which is almost always welcome, especially
if you have a lot of vegetarians.  A salad, if you have people to cut.  You
could add more pies if you used already prepared crusts that day if you had
someone to do the prep work.  Maybe you could add mushroom pasties instead,
Cariadoc's recipe is good.
